Buying Guide for 14 Gauge Corten Steel
Understanding 14 Gauge Corten Steel
When I first looked into 14 gauge Corten steel, I realized it’s a specific thickness of weathering steel, roughly 0.0747 inches thick. This gauge offers a good balance between strength and workability, making it ideal for various outdoor projects. Knowing the gauge helps me ensure I get the right durability and flexibility for my needs.
Benefits of Choosing Corten Steel
What drew me to Corten steel was its unique ability to form a stable rust-like appearance after exposure to weather. This natural patina protects the steel from further corrosion, which means less maintenance over time. I appreciate that this steel ages beautifully and is highly resistant to atmospheric corrosion.
Applications for 14 Gauge Corten Steel
I found that 14 gauge Corten steel works well for garden sculptures, architectural features, planters, and outdoor furniture. Its thickness is sturdy enough for structural elements while still being manageable for cutting and welding. Considering my project requirements, this gauge often hits the sweet spot between durability and ease of fabrication.

Handling and Maintenance Tips
Although Corten steel is low-maintenance, I learned that proper handling is essential to achieve the desired patina. Initially, it requires exposure to alternating wet and dry conditions. I also avoid using sealants unless necessary because they can interfere with the natural weathering process. Regular inspections help me catch any issues early.
